Cybersecurity Awareness Lectures
Overview
Within the framework of the comprehensive national strategy to spread awareness among individuals and organizations to achieve the Economic Vision 2030 and reinforce sustainable development goals, the National Cyber Security Center aims to foster a positive cyber security culture in organizations and among individuals. Sessions and workshops promote best practices and provide essential education to identify potential threats and ways of protection and response.
